Ploughshare wrote:
> ...I was actually thinking about purchasing another Glaser Wheel Hoe this year.
> The price on them seems so ridiculous though--Peaceful Valley has them
> (steel handles) for something like $350 and they don't even come with the
> hoe. I use ours quite a bit and a 2nd one would be nice, they just seem so
> overpriced for what materials are there....
>
You can buy old Planet Jrs. on eBay any day of the week for $40-100 +
shipping depending upon condition and tooling, or if you are in an area
with an agricultural history you may find them at estate and small farm
auctions. I've probably bought at least a dozen in my area,
Central/Western NY, over the past several years. At auction, at least
in NY they usually go for $5-$45 depending upon condition.
I have looked at manufacturing a modern version of the Planet Jr.,
similar to the Glaser, but a little sturdier and the price they are
asking is not out of line considering the small number which are
manufactured and the steps in the distribution chain between the
manufacturer and ultimate seller.
